Replace kitchen ceiling - size of room is 18'8" x 9'3" (5.7m x 2.82m). Remove existing lath and plaster ceiling and put up a new one, including plastering.
Scott and his team put it 2new ceilings for us and replastered. We were very happy with the work which was done to a high standard and for a good price. We have an old house and after taking down the old ceilings/plaster, there were a couple of problems exposed such as wet bricks from a leaking roof. Despite the inconvenience to himself of having to delay the work, Scott explained these problems and gave us time to get in roofers. All in all a pleasure to work with and highly recommended!

Penetrating damp has caused significant damage to an internal wall. The external cause has now been repaired, but there is damp in the wall and also the window frames. I need someone to assess the damage and quote for the job.
Excellent work, very reliable, trustworthy and punctual, kept me updated on the work throughout, including emailing me photos of the progress, which was impressive given the problems turned out to be much more complicated than initially thought. Clearly had knowledge of the damp problems, very experienced. Also did the work just before Christmas, struggled in through the snow. I recommend them highly.

Block off external doorway with cavity wall on ground floor extension of late Victorian terrace house. Blocks for inner leaf and reclaimed bricks (supplied) for external wall to match. Provide a rectangular opening in the new wall approx 160mm x 210mm and about 120mm above interior ground level for later installation of a cat flap. Match pointing, fit DPC, wall ties, cavity wall insulation (thermal insulation panel), etc. Please quote for labour and materials except for reclaimed bricks (yellow London stock) which is supplied.

I have a small kitchen extension that was unfortunately built with only a single layer of brick. The room gets damp and mold grows on the walls in the winter. I would like to have the existing wall treated for mold. I'd like an inner wall built and insulation added between the two layers. I would also like the roof of this extension repaired or rebuilt, whatever is more practical. Additionally, the kitchen is badly ventilated. I would like to have an extractor fan and new window (replacement of existing window) added above the cooker and possibly the replacement of two ineffectual air bricks.
